Challenge: Transform the cave-like character of the original residence into an open and day-lit environment with multiple outdoor views. Add a new master suite with a home office.
Concepts: The dining area was widened into a day-lit hub where spaces and activities overlap, opening horizontally to the kitchen, living-room and yard, as well as vertically to the master suite above. Existing modernist cues were reinforced via a minimalist vocabulary of clean lines and exposed structure. Tall transom windows afforded by the master suite upward-sweeping roof eaves, provide optimal second-floor views and daylighting.
